    TypeDB: a strongly-typed database

    ...Through TypeQL, TypeDB provides powerful abstractions over low-level and complex data patterns. TypeDB allows you to model your domain based on logical and object-oriented principles. Composed of entity, relationship, and attribute types, as well as type hierarchies, roles, and rules, TypeDB allows you to think higher-level, as opposed to join-tables, columns, documents, vertices, edges, and properties.Types provide a way to describe the logical structures of your data, allowing TypeDB to validate that your code inserts and queries data correctly.

    Apricot DB

    Apricot DB

    Database ERD- design tool with Reverse Engineering

    Design/Reverse Engineer/Generate Scripts/Compare Versions of all major databases with "Apricot DB" ERD- tool "Apricot DB" is a database tool for design and analysis of the relational database structure. It represents the DB- structure in the form of editable Entity/Relationship Diagrams (ERD). "Apricot DB" allows to perform reverse engineering on the existing database, as well as to create a new database structure from scratch. Allows to generate the essential DDL- scripts for CREATE/DROP/DELETE- operations based on the current ERD. "Apricot DB" supports two popular ERD notations: the "Crow's Foot" and "IDEF1x". ...

    SchemaSpy analyzes database metadata to reverse engineer dynamic Entity Relationship (ER) diagrams. It works with just about any JDBC-compliant database (Oracle/MySQL/DB2/SQL Server/PostgreSQL/Sybase/etc) and can identify Ruby on Rails relationships.

    aSVERD is a little system for generating Entity Relationship Diagrams (ERD) as Scalable Vector Graphics (SVG). SVG can be viewed and zoomed in a Web Browser. The diagrams can be edited with an SVG editor and round-trip updated against the database.

    Yet Another Database Designer - the goal of the project is to develop a tool for designing relational databases. YAD_Designer is based on the entity relationship model (see Chen et al.) and is targeted on the use in educational environments.
